Output 660e3c766858060749dcc7d8085c16aff80a031f3a238faade97f6b89d057711:5

value
3188646
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 4fc3da656ae78c1d9bf7376181104586ff7fc810fcf613017109a1cb1e6a35bb
address
tb1pflpa5et2u7xpmxlhxasczyz9smlhljqslnmpxqt3pxsuk8n2xkasc8jeft
transaction
660e3c766858060749dcc7d8085c16aff80a031f3a238faade97f6b89d057711